Freedom
If a free society cannot help the many who are poor, it cannot save the few who are rich.
- John F. Kennedy
It has been said that each generation must win its own struggle to be free.
- Robert F. Kennedy
Freedom begins the moment you realize someone else has been writing your story and it's time you took the pen from his hand and started writing it yourself.
- Bill Moyers
Freedom is nothing else but a chance to be better.
- Albert Camus
Love and freedom are such hideous words. So many cruelties have been done in their name.
- Joseph O'connor
So long as we are brave enough to accept the consequences of our actions, no one can take away our freedom of choice.
- Mike Norton
Concentrated power has always been the enemy of liberty.
- Ronald Reagan
There are people who are willing to protect freedom until there is nothing left of it.
- Heinar Kipphardt
Only free men can negotiate, prisoners cannot enter into contracts.
- Nelson Mandela
The only way to achieve freedom is to free your mind from the world we live in.
- Salvatore Palladino
